These gourds are made out of a fruit called Calabash & have to be cured before use.

 

Please note: we do not cure the gourd as that is a personal journey & we have instructions as to how to cure the gourd that will come with your purchase. Gourds usually take between 2-5 days to cure.

 

Combined with the loose leaf tea filter straw called a Bombilla, the dream team for an amazing Yerba Maté experience. The filter straw can be used not only with Yerba Maté but also loose leaf teas such as Herbal Blends, Damiana, Blue Lotus, Chamomile, etc.

 

Simply place your Yerba Maté (or other loose-leaf herbal tea) in the cup, add the straw to the cup.

Next step is that you want to protect the herb you have placed in the gourd to be brewed: the best way to achieve this is by adding a few table spoons of cold water to the herb.

 

Bring your water to the boil and allow to cool for at least a few minutes: bringing the temperature down to below 75 degrees Celsius - [once again to protect the herb from being COOKED instead of brewed]

 

Place your filter straw (bombilla) inside your cup and begin the enjoyment.

Continue to top up your cup with hot water until the Yerba Mate sinks to the bottom of the cup.
